A doctor who specialises into taking good care of and treating our kidneys are called Nephrologists. People with acute renal failure and chronic kidney diseases or urinary tract infections are the ones who most commonly see a Nephrologist. Resolving blood or protein loss in the urine and kidney stones is also done by this doctor.
The signs and symptoms that are an indication of a kidney condition are as follows:
It is the increased swelling which is a very common indication of a kidney condition and it could be around eyes, ankles, feet or legs. A kidney condition may be imminent with gastrointestinal issues like nausea, vomiting and a decreased appetite. The issues related to kidney are also known to be there with signs like high blood pressure and anemia.

When you start showing signs and symptoms that could indicate a kidney issue, your doctor will refer you to a Nephrologist. Of the various responsibilities that are manned by the Nephrologists, one is managing chronic kidney disease and acute kidney failure. In order to help the kidneys function well, doctors treat Tubular/interstitial disorders and Glomerular/vascular disorders. It is not just hypertension but mineral metabolism disorders are managed by these doctors.

The right picture about the condition of the kidney is given through blood and urine tests. A kidney ultrasound can also be recommended by the doctor based on the situation. On a case to case basis a kidney biopsy can also be done to figure out the condition of the kidneys.
You must consult a Nephrologist if their is an ongoing health condition that is affecting your kidney function. This doctor treats people with a variety of kidney issues such as Tubular/interstitial disorders, Glomerular/vascular disorders and even those who require dialysis often. Procedures such as Kidney transplantation also required a lot of preparation, a Nephrologist helps you through the same. The Nephrologist's role also comes in in situations when patient's kidneys are failing or they have a serious kidney disease.
